Looking to do something sorta like this but without the wood:



Will moon hubcaps and trim rings work with the stock steel wheels or is there a specific after market wheel that must be used? Also, any suggestions on places to get stuff like the chrome bits other than California Cruisers? I read the thread on them, and seems like they need to be avoided.

you need a differnt rim. The rims are from wheels vintique, if you buy them direct, you'll have to have someone paint or powdercoat unless you go for all-chrome http://www.wheelvintiques.com/

See mitzkity's gallery for more pix. They make em in smoothies (like above) or in ralley style. but you need that for the moons and trim rings to work.
